Output 7513efc16a18ed6903e8480c8e7f4e900409f81927c3e6da2eb6855a68a3a525:0

value
18642641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71eac2e76d6e130e1f25e0ee896ab13d248dac63 OP_EQUAL
address
3C5MWizCwNLxZwLfxBBeMeG1GKycoe4QtJ
transaction
7513efc16a18ed6903e8480c8e7f4e900409f81927c3e6da2eb6855a68a3a525
spent
true